35th Anniversary 2nd Chance Winner Ron Black

After winning the final 2nd chance draw from the Idaho Lottery's 35th Anniversary Games, Ron Black, from Boise, decided that perhaps it was time to retire his well-worn, VIP Club card. Ron was the final winner of the monthly draws, claiming $52,712 from a jackpot that started at $3,000 on July 1 and grew until the end of the month.

Ron is a long-time Idaho Lottery VIP Club player. He regularly participates in the Lottery's Sweepstakes and 2nd Chance drawings.

"I wasn't interested in being one of the Cake Finalists," said Ron referring to the five finalists at the Lottery's 35th Anniversary Celebration at The Village in Meridian in July. "I had been saving my tickets for the final month and entered them all at once."

The strategy paid off as he became the sixth 2nd Chance jackpot winner for the 35th Anniversary games. When he arrived at the Lottery Office, Ron was equally excited to replace his VIP Club card as he was to claim his cash prize.

"It has become difficult to scan at the stores," said Ron as Lottery Customer Service produced a new VIP Club card for him while he was there. Still, Ron planned to keep the old card. "I'm going to take it home and put it with the big check as a little memento."

Ron is hoping the prize money will provide a bit of cushion for him and will be able to help his three daughters.
